Extracellular matrix-related genes play an important role in the progression of NMIBC to MIBC: a bioinformatics analysis study
1 May 2020
Abstract excerpt
Bladder cancer is the 11th most common cancer in the world. Bladder cancer can be roughly divided into muscle invasive bladder cancer (MIBC) and non-muscle invasive bladder cancer (NMIBC). The aim of the present study was to identify the key genes and pathways associated with the progression of NMIBC to MIBC and to further analyze its molecular mechanism and prognostic significance.
